A words to pages converter is a free online tool that estimates how many pages a given word count or block of text will fill. It turns a number like 1000 words into a page-count estimate so you can plan an essay, report, or article before you finish writing.
The estimate depends on font, font size, spacing, and margins, so the same word count can span different page totals. This converter uses common defaults of 12pt Times New Roman or Arial, single or double spaced, with standard one inch margins, and lets you adjust each setting to match your document.

This chart shows common word counts mapped to an estimated page count, using 12pt Times New Roman or Arial with one inch margins. Single spaced fits roughly 500 words per page and double spaced fits roughly 250 words per page. Use it as a quick reference, then fine tune with the tool above:
| Word count | Single spaced | Double spaced |
|---|---|---|
| 250 words | 0.5 page | 1 page |
| 500 words | 1 page | 2 pages |
| 750 words | 1.5 pages | 3 pages |
| 1000 words | 2 pages | 4 pages |
| 1500 words | 3 pages | 6 pages |
| 2000 words | 4 pages | 8 pages |
| 2500 words | 5 pages | 10 pages |
| 3000 words | 6 pages | 12 pages |
| 5000 words | 10 pages | 20 pages |

About 1000 words is roughly 2 pages single spaced or 4 pages double spaced, using 12pt Times New Roman or Arial with one inch margins. The exact page count shifts with the font, font size, spacing, and margins you choose.
About 500 words is roughly 1 page single spaced or 2 pages double spaced at 12pt in Times New Roman or Arial with one inch margins. Switching font, size, or margins can move the estimate up or down by a fraction of a page.
About 2000 words is roughly 8 pages double spaced at 12pt in Times New Roman or Arial with one inch margins. Single spaced, the same 2000 words fills around 4 pages, since double spacing nearly doubles the height each line uses.
Yes. Font choice, font size, line spacing, and margins all change how many words fit on a page. A larger font or double spacing produces more pages, while a condensed font, smaller size, or tighter margins fits more words per page.
The tool estimates words per line from the usable page width and average word width, then lines per page from the usable height and line spacing. Words per line times lines per page gives words per page, and your total words divided by that gives the page count.
